Switzerland vs. New Zealand: Two Masters of Natural Spectacle
The Alpine Kingdom vs. The Pacific Realm of Adventure
Comparing Switzerland and New Zealand is like choosing between two grandmasters of the natural world, each with a completely different fighting style. Switzerland is the master of elegant, concentrated Alpine beauty—a postcard-perfect world of sharp peaks and serene lakes. New Zealand is the master of raw, sprawling coastal and volcanic drama—an epic fantasy realm of fjords, glaciers, and subtropical forests.
The Most Striking Contrasts
The Lay of the Land: Switzerland is famously landlocked, a vertical world where life is lived between, and on top of, mountains. New Zealand is an island nation, defined by its 15,000 kilometers of stunning, varied coastline. One looks inward to its peaks; the other looks outward to the endless ocean.
Vibe and Culture: Swiss culture is one of reserved precision, order, and a quiet, formal elegance. New Zealand culture is famously laid-back, informal, and adventurous, blending its European heritage with a deep and visible Māori culture. It’s the difference between a classical concert hall and a thrilling outdoor rock festival.
Economic Focus: While both have strong agricultural and tourism sectors, their cores differ. Switzerland is a powerhouse of finance, pharmaceuticals, and luxury manufacturing. New Zealand is a giant in agriculture (dairy, meat, wine) and has branded itself as the adventure capital of the world.
The Quality vs. Quantity Paradox
Both countries rank exceptionally high on global quality-of-life indexes. Switzerland’s quality comes from its immense wealth, leading to flawless infrastructure, high salaries, and perfect public services. It’s a manufactured perfection. New Zealand’s quality of life is more tied to work-life balance and access to nature. It’s a more rugged, do-it-yourself lifestyle where wealth is measured in experiences, not just bank balances. You pay for perfection in Switzerland; you create your own adventure in New Zealand.

💡 Surprise Fact
Switzerland's highest peak, Dufourspitze, is 4,634 meters high. While impressive, all of Switzerland could fit inside New Zealand almost seven times over. Switzerland is compact intensity; New Zealand is sprawling majesty.
